What will be covered in the next three weeks?

  • In Week 1 we will present the story of the COVID-19 pandemic so far, and describe the basics of assessing viral genomes.
  • In Week 2 we will explore SARS-CoV-2 in terms of its mechanism of infection, and show how this knowledge can be used to develop vaccines and other therapeutics. We will also describe and explore the implications of SARS-CoV-2 variants.
  • Finally, in Week 3 we will show how the many layers of genomic knowledge can be used to guide public health policies and strategies.
